What Is an Aircraft Mechanic?

An Aircraft Mechanic is a trained aviation technician responsible for maintaining, inspecting, repairing, and servicing aircraft to ensure they remain safe, airworthy, and compliant with regulations. Aircraft mechanics work on a wide range of systems including airframes, engines, avionics, hydraulics, landing gear, and environmental systems.

 

Not all aircraft mechanics hold the same certifications. There are two main pathways:

  • Aircraft Mechanic (Non-A&P)

  • Aircraft Maintenance Technician (A&P Certified)

 

Both roles contribute to aircraft safety, but each has different responsibilities, privileges, and career opportunities. Aircraft mechanics are employed by airlines, corporate aviation departments, MRO facilities, repair stations, manufacturers, flight schools, cargo operators, and the military.

 

Their work requires mechanical skill, attention to detail, discipline, and the ability to follow technical manuals and FAA procedures.

How to Start Your Journey as an Aircraft Mechanic

 

1. Meet basic eligibility requirements

  • At least 18 years old

  • Ability to read, write, speak, and understand English

  • Willingness to work nights, weekends, holidays, and shift schedules

  • Strong mechanical aptitude and attention to detail

 

2. Choose your mechanic pathway

 

You can enter the field in two different ways:

Pathway 1: Aircraft Mechanic (Non-A&P)

 

This pathway allows you to work in aviation maintenance without the FAA A&P certification. These mechanics cannot sign off major repairs or return an aircraft to service but can perform valuable work under supervision.

 

Where non-A&P mechanics work:

  • Aircraft manufacturing (Boeing, Airbus, Gulfstream)

  • Component repair shops

  • Avionics installation and wiring teams

  • Military maintenance units

  • UAV and drone maintenance

  • Line service tech roles at airports

  • Interior refurbishment and modification shops

 

Common responsibilities:

  • Assisting with inspections

  • Performing basic repairs or installations

  • Working on avionics, interiors, structures, or manufacturing

  • Helping A&P mechanics with component replacement

  • Learning systems on-the-job

 

Many non-A&P mechanics eventually pursue their A&P once they gain experience.

Pathway 2: Aircraft Maintenance Technician (A&P Certified)

 

This is the more advanced pathway and opens the door to more responsibility and higher-level jobs. A&P stands for Airframe & Powerplant—the FAA credentials required to sign aircraft logbooks and legally return aircraft to service.

 

Where A&P mechanics work:

  • Airlines (line & heavy maintenance)

  • Cargo carriers

  • Corporate and business aviation

  • MRO facilities

  • Flight schools

  • Air ambulance and regional operators

  • AOG (Aircraft on Ground) rapid response teams

 

Common responsibilities:

  • Inspecting airframes, engines, and major systems

  • Troubleshooting electrical, hydraulic, and mechanical issues

  • Repairing structural components

  • Conducting routine and non-routine inspections

  • Documenting logbook entries and airworthiness releases

  • Ensuring full FAA Part 43 compliance

 

A&P mechanics carry legal responsibility for the work they sign off, making this role critical to aviation safety.

Training Pathways for Aircraft Mechanics

 

Option A: Attend an FAA Part 147 Aviation Maintenance School

 

Most common route. Programs last 12–24 months and include training in:

  • Airframe systems

  • Powerplant systems

  • Electrical and avionics basics

  • Hydraulics and fuel systems

  • Turbine and piston engine theory

  • Structural repairs

Graduates qualify to take the A&P exams.

 

Option B: On-the-Job Experience (OJT)

 

Mechanics can qualify for the A&P tests by accumulating:

  • 18 months of airframe experience or

  • 18 months of powerplant experience or

  • 30 months of combined experience

Often completed through military service or repair stations.

 

Option C: Military Aviation Maintenance

 

Aircraft maintainers in the Air Force, Navy, Marines, or Army can credit their experience to earn their A&P after service.

 

FAA Certification (A&P pathway only):

  • 3 written exams (General, Airframe, Powerplant)

  • Oral exam

  • Practical exam

Career Pathways Within Aircraft Mechanics

Line Maintenance Mechanic

 

Works at airports on aircraft between flights.

 

Responsibilities include:

  • Troubleshooting discrepancies

  • Fixing write-ups from pilots

  • Performing daily and transit checks

  • Responding to AOG events

  • Servicing fluids and systems

Heavy Maintenance / Base Mechanic

 

Works in hangars performing major inspections and overhauls.

 

Responsibilities include:

  • Structural inspections

  • Landing gear and system overhauls

  • Cabin and interior work

  • Complete system tests

  • Major component replacements

Avionics Technician

 

Specializes in aircraft electronics.

 

Responsibilities include:

  • Installing and repairing radios, navigation, and autopilot systems

  • Diagnosing electrical faults

  • Updating flight management systems

  • Working on wiring and circuitry

Powerplant / Engine Technician

 

Works specifically on turbine or piston engines.

 

Responsibilities include:

  • Engine removal and installation

  • Hot-section inspections

  • Borescope evaluations

  • Performance runs and testing

  • Fuel and ignition system troubleshooting

Maintenance Controller

 

A senior technical support role in airline operations centers.

 

Responsibilities include:

  • Supporting mechanics in the field

  • Making go/no-go decisions

  • Approving MEL (Minimum Equipment List) items

  • Coordinating with pilots, dispatchers, and safety teams

  • Ensuring compliance with Part 121 regulations

Trends & Opportunities in Aircraft Mechanics

  • Major global shortage of certified mechanics

  • Airlines offering higher pay, bonuses, and relocation packages

  • Growth in corporate aviation maintenance and business jets

  • Demand for technicians trained in composites and advanced materials

  • Increased need for UAV and drone maintenance technicians

  • Rise of electric aircraft and eVTOL maintenance roles

  • Greater use of digital maintenance tools and real-time diagnostics
